The Inspiration Behind a Famous Song
One of the most interesting parts of Annie Martell’s story is her connection to one of the most beloved songs in folk music.
John Denver wrote “Annie’s Song” as a tribute to her. The track became a massive hit and remains one of his signature pieces.
How the Song Was Created
The story behind the song is surprisingly simple.
After a disagreement with Annie, John went on a ski lift ride to clear his mind. During that quiet moment surrounded by the beauty of nature, inspiration struck.
In just about ten minutes, he wrote the song.

Divorce and Moving Forward
After several years together, Annie Martell and John Denver divorced in 1982.
For fans, the news came as a surprise. After all, the love expressed in “Annie’s Song” seemed timeless.
